Maryland startups travel to Silicon Valley conference

03/28/2023 | Amanda Winters

A delegation of Maryland startup companies are attending the Startup Grind Global Conference next month in Silicon Valley, Ca.

The delegation, led by the Maryland Department of Commerce, includes AGED Diagnostics  (North Bethesda); Astek Diagnostics  (Baltimore); BLYNK  (Baltimore); Celcy Technologies  (Eldersburg); Keep Company  (Bethesda); Medcura  (Riverdale); Pathotrak  (College Park); and ReBokeh  (Towson).

Four of the eight participating companies have been selected by Startup Grind to participate in its Accelerate Program taking place before the conference, including Astek Diagnostics, a medtech startup that developed a system for rapid antibiotic sensitivity testing for urinary tract infections.

"We are deeply committed to revolutionizing infection detection and treatment, and we believe our one-hour antibiotic sensitivity test is a vital step in that direction,” said Mustafa Al-Adhami, PhD, CEO of Astek Diagnostics. “We are honored to represent Maryland at Startup Grind, and we are driven by the belief that our work can help prevent devastating outcomes like sepsis, ultimately saving countless lives and sparing families from unimaginable grief. This event serves as a powerful platform to raise awareness and inspire action in the fight against life-threatening infections."

“We believe this event can provide countless opportunities for our local startups, and help attract additional investors to Maryland’s innovative business community,” said Maryland Commerce Secretary Kevin A. Anderson.
